The Yakima Baseline system is designed for vehicles without roof rails or gutters, offering a tailored set of four rack towers that secure quietly and securely to bare roofs. The product supports multiple Yakima crossbars, including JetStream, HD Bar, CoreBar, and RoundBar, delivering versatility for different setups. A Tri-axial DropHook clip adjustment accommodates various roof shapes, while the BarBed provides 12-degree pitch adjustment to keep bars level on curved roofs. This system emphasizes a low-profile, low-noise profile for urban and highway driving, and the four-tower configuration promotes stable load distribution across the roof. Compatible crossbars create a flexible mounting platform for a range of cargo needs without rails.

Installation is guided by the multi-tower design and adaptive adjustments, which help ensure a secure fit across diverse vehicle profiles. The system emphasizes compatibility and durability, making it suitable for weekend getaways or daily transport tasks where roof cargo is needed without the presence of factory rails. When selecting crossbars, ensure your chosen Yakima crossbars match the vehicle’s load requirements and roof contour for optimal performance and noise reduction.

Buying Guide

  • Vehicle compatibility: Bare roofs require different mounting feet than vehicles with rails. Check your car’s roof type (bare, flush, raised rails) and confirm fitment with each system.
  • Load capacity: Match the system’s maximum load to your typical gear. Consider future needs and ensure the bars can support bikes, kayaks, or cargo boxes without overloading.
  • Security: Locking feet and anti-theft features help protect gear when parked. Evaluate whether you need keyed locks or additional security accessories.
  • Aerodynamics and noise: Aerodynamic designs reduce wind noise and drag. If your driving is frequent, prioritize low-profile crossbars and smoother finishes.
  • Adjustability and installation: Systems with adjustable spans and easy-to-use mounting feet save time and improve fit across diverse roofs.
  • Crossbar material: Aluminum is lightweight and corrosion-resistant; steel options are strong but heavier. Consider environment and maintenance needs.
  • Installation footprint: Some kits require drilling or specialized tools. Verify required tools and whether professional installation is advisable.
  • Accessory ecosystem: If you plan to add bike racks, cargo baskets, or kayak holders, ensure compatibility with the chosen crossbars’ T-slots and mounting points.
  • Warranty and support: Look for brands offering warranty coverage and responsive customer support for mounting questions or accessory compatibility.
